Huddersfield Town transfer news: Ryan Schofield recalled as it is confirmed Lee Nicholls is out for season - plus Mark Fotheringham on Sorba Thomas loan
The news about the goalkeeper has been feared for a while, but it has been confirmed after the Merseysider went under the knife to cure a shoulder problem.
And the decision to loan Sorba Thomas to Blackburn Rovers might have given the Terriers a touch more wriggle room to operate in at a time when budgets are tight.

"Lee's had an operation, he will be out for the rest of the season, which is unfortunate because he's a fantastic keeper," said coach Fotheringham.
"Not only is he a good keeper, he's a really good person and a leader in the group as well so we're going to miss him dearly."
Nicholas Bilokapic, a 20-year-old Australian, made his league debut for Town at Hull City in Nicholls' place.
